The Department of Environmental Protection will present and seek comment on a draft recovery strategy that is designed to meet the Lower Santa Fe and Ichetucknee Rivers minimum flows currently under development. Purpose: The purpose of rule development is to strike the previously-adopted minimum flows for the Lower Santa Fe and Ichetucknee Rivers and Priority Springs (LSFIR) and adopt new minimum flows for the LSFIR and any associated recovery and prevention strategy. The minimum flows for the LSFIR and any associated recovery and prevention strategy will generally affect consumptive use permittees and may affect applicants for surface water management permits in all applicable water management districts without the need for further rulemaking by the water management districts.
